Just to elaborate a bit on the context.  In my original question that I have removed, I mentioned that I had tried everything on the official Help section with no success.  What I then did was update my iOS, and had my device forgotten in the iPhone Bluetooth settings.  I am not sure which of these two events did the trick... but afterward when I relaunched FitBit, my watch was syncing properly again.
